⚡ Installation

📦 From VSCode Marketplace (Recommended)

  1. Open VSCode Extensions panel (Ctrl+Shift+X or Cmd+Shift+X)
  2. Search for "SilkCircuit Theme"
  3. Click Install on the official extension by hyperb1iss
  4. Open Command Palette (Ctrl+Shift+P / Cmd+Shift+P)
  5. Type "Preferences: Color Theme"
  6. Select your preferred SilkCircuit variant

⚡ Quick Install via Command Line

# Once published to marketplace:
code --install-extension hyperb1iss.silkcircuit-theme

🔧 Manual Installation

  1. Copy the entire vscode/ folder to VSCode extensions directory:
    • Windows: %USERPROFILE%\\.vscode\\extensions\\silkcircuit-theme\\
    • macOS: ~/.vscode/extensions/silkcircuit-theme/
    • Linux: ~/.vscode/extensions/silkcircuit-theme/
  2. Restart VSCode
  3. Ctrl+Shift+P → "Preferences: Color Theme"
  4. Select your preferred SilkCircuit variant

Option 3: Individual Theme Files

Just want one theme? Copy the JSON file to:

  • Windows: %APPDATA%\\Code\\User\\themes\\
  • macOS: ~/Library/Application Support/Code/User/themes/
  • Linux: ~/.config/Code/User/themes/

⚙️ True Glow Effects (Advanced)

VSCode themes are static JSON - no real glow effects possible. For actual glowing text:

Using Custom CSS Extension

  1. Install "Custom CSS and JS Loader" extension
  2. Add to settings.json:
{
  "vscode_custom_css.imports": ["file:///path/to/silkcircuit-glow.css"]
}
  1. Create silkcircuit-glow.css:
/* Functions with glow effect */
.token.function {
  text-shadow: 0 0 5px #80ffea, 0 0 10px #80ffea, 0 0 15px #80ffea;
}

/* Keywords with purple glow */
.token.keyword {
  text-shadow: 0 0 5px #e135ff, 0 0 10px #e135ff;
}

/* Strings with pink glow */
.token.string {
  text-shadow: 0 0 5px #ff99ff, 0 0 10px #ff99ff;
}
  1. Reload VSCode with custom CSS enabled

Creating Your Own Extension

For full control, create a VSCode extension that:

  1. Applies the theme
  2. Injects custom CSS for glow effects
  3. Adds animation capabilities

💜 Color Palette

Color Hex Preview Usage
Background #0a0a0f #0a0a0f Editor background
Foreground #e0e0e0 #e0e0e0 Default text
Purple #e135ff #e135ff Keywords, types
Pink #ff79c6 #ff79c6 Strings, attributes
Cyan #80ffea #80ffea Functions, methods
Green #50fa7b #50fa7b Success, valid
Yellow #f1fa8c #f1fa8c Variables, warnings
Orange #ffb86c #ffb86c Numbers, constants

🎛️ Variant Intensity

Element Neon Vibrant Soft Glow
Keywords #e135ff #bc4dd9 #a766b3 #ec69ff
Strings #ff99ff #d9b3d9 #c199b3 #ffb3ff
Functions #80ffea #80d9c7 #80b3a1 #9dffed
Comments #9580ff #9180d9 #8d80b3 #a999ff
